Here’s one from Bluejacket (300 Tingey Street, SE): “The Navy Yard brewery will tap a brand-new double IPA for the occasion: 86 Years. A reference to how long it’s been since a Washington baseball team has made it to the World Series, 86 Years is a hazy double IPA double dry-hopped with Galaxy – it’s a juicy fruit bomb of a brew that shows intense notes of passionfruit, peach and orange, and it goes on draft Tuesday in time for Game 1. From ABRA:

“Congratulations to the Washington Nationals for sweeping the 2019 National League Championship Series and clinching their first trip to the World Series!

If you are an ABC licensee interested in hosting a Watch Party or related event and want to extend your approved hours of operation, you must file a One-Day Substantial Change Application.

Applications for indoor events and outdoor events on private space must be filed at least seven days prior to the event date. Applications for outdoor events on public space must be filed 20 days in advance. All applications are subject to approval by the Alcoholic Beverage Control Board.

Please note the same process applies for establishments wanting to charge a cover or offer live entertainment or allow dancing–if their license does not have such an endorsement.

Applications and additional details are available on ABRA’s website.”
